Avant Window Navigator
Avant Window Navgator (Awn) is a dock-like bar which sits at the bottom of the screen (in all its composited-goodness) tracking open windows.
Awn uses libwnck to keep a track of open windows, and behaves exactly like a normal window-list:
- Clicking an icon switches to that window, clicking again will minimise the window
- Right-clicking will bring up a menu extactly like that of what you see on the window-list, allowing you to max, min, close, resize etc the window.
- Dragging something on top of an icon will activate that window.
- Visually (and quite attractively) responds to 'needs attention' & 'urgent' events
- Can show windows from the entire viewport, or just the visible viewport.
